Poster Frames vs Picture Frames: What’s the Difference?

If you're browsing both 30 x 40 poster frames and 30 x 30 picture frames at IKEA, the main difference lies in the intended use. Poster frames are typically thinner and lighter, designed to showcase flat prints without matting. Picture frames, on the other hand, may include mat boards, thicker borders, and are better suited for family photos or art pieces requiring more depth.

For instance, a 30x30 picture frame from IKEA often has a square profile that fits symmetrical prints or abstract art beautifully. Meanwhile, a 40 x 30 frame might be better suited for landscape photography or horizontal compositions.

IKEA Frame Variants: Exploring Other Dimensions

  • 30 x 30 frame IKEA: Great for symmetrical prints or square artwork. These are especially popular for gallery wall arrangements or Instagram-style photo layouts.

  • 30 x 45 frame IKEA: Slightly taller than the standard 30x40, this size offers a unique aspect ratio perfect for vertically composed art.

  • 40 x 30 frame IKEA: This horizontal orientation is perfect for landscapes or wide illustrations. It's ideal when you want to fill a wider space without going too large.

No matter the dimension, IKEA frames tend to follow a consistent philosophy: functionality, ease of use, and design simplicity. Sizes like 30x40, 30x30, and 40x30 also align with common international paper sizes, making them flexible for both personal and professional use.
